The Connecticut shore is pretty in places, but not a dramatic sea coast. In April it's still cool, so I don't expect you'll be lounging on the sand. I think your best bet would be the area around Mystic -- in particular The Inn at Stonington in Stonington Borough http://www.innatstonington.com/. The borough is beautiful with well preserved 17th and 18th century buildings. Nearby is Mystic, a small village featuring Mystic Seaport, http://www.mysticseaport.org/ which has ships and a recreated 19th century village. Good of its type and not-to-miss if you love traditional boats and sailing ships. There is also an aquarium by the highway. Not great but worth a few hours.
Newport Rhode Island is about an hour away. It has its famous mansions, a scenic beach, a good walk and good restaurants. You might consider using it as your base instead. If not, you'd probably enjoy it as a day trip.
